Description

Scope of Position

This is a dual role that serves in a unique capacity as ambassador for new/existing members of Alterna. The incumbent must quickly and efficiently probe to uncover and assess overall needs of all members (at every contact) and identify opportunities for cross-sell, up sell, and meet the needs of all mass market members by providing appropriate education, advice, products and services. They will also identify members with more complex needs and refer to their appropriate branch partner or Senior Bankers.

In addition, this role requires the Associate to maintain a cash drawer and service members accordingly.

The Personal Banking Associate contributes to the team’s sales plan through effective assessment of members’ financial needs and providing product and service solutions to satisfy primary needs. Proactively promotes, up sells, and delivers a full range of banking products and services. Deals primarily with member-initiated contact.

Major Responsibilities

  • Follows all sales and service processes
  • Meet sales targets by delivering products and services that satisfy the members’ primary need.
  • Probes to uncover additional needs to cross sell and up sell at every member interaction
  • Provides education and advice to members on basic transactional banking and less complex investment and credit situations.
  • Transaction posting, cash management (including balancing), administrative, and security /risk management procedures will be executed with the highest level of accuracy.
  • Identify and refer high value or high potential members to appropriate staff.
  • Through opportunity spotting, maximizes growth and retention, contributing to overall Branch goals
  • Attends and actively partakes in branch meetings, huddles, sales initiatives, and campaigns.
  • Is available for walk in traffic and other member-initiated contact.
  • Acts as a member of both the MSR and Sales teams.
  • Maintain a solid working knowledge and understanding of all products and services we offer and keeps up to date with procedural changes including new accounts, investments, loans and mortgages.
  • Is proficient in the use of sales and service tools to support member interactions
  • Identify and set personal development plan; completes activities set out in the plan, influencing Employee engagement and enablement.
  • Actively participate in regular weekly goal setting meeting and coaching sessions.
  • Compliant with anti money laundering guidelines and other compliance and regulatory guidelines.
  • Actively participates in community initiatives as determined by the Branch, or more broadly as part of Alterna.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
  • Personal sales/ service targets will be met or exceeded as determined by the Branch AOP
  • Members will view the organization as exceeding their expectations in terms of service quality
  • Alignment of individual contributions to Financial Performance; Member Engagement and Community Impact goals of Alterna.

About Alterna Savings

Alterna Savings and Credit Union Limited (Alterna) has been the Good in Banking for over 115 years creating financial services that transform lives for the better, all while giving back to our community. Alterna is made up of Alterna Savings and Credit Union Limited and its wholly owned subsidiary, Alterna Bank.

As the first full-service, member-owned cooperative financial institution outside Quebec, Alterna Savings shares its expertise with over 210,000 members through a network of over 40 branches across Ontario, as well as call centre and digital channels. Members and customers also benefit from an industry-leading online brokerage and investment management services.
